nilfs2: convert nilfs_segctor_complete_write to use folios
authorMatthew Wilcox (Oracle) <willy@infradead.org>
Tue, 14 Nov 2023 08:44:19 +0000 (17:44 +0900)
committerAndrew Morton <akpm@linux-foundation.org>
Mon, 11 Dec 2023 01:21:26 +0000 (17:21 -0800)
Use the new folio APIs, saving five calls to compound_head().  This
includes the last callers of nilfs_end_page_io(), so remove that too.
